Your Opportunity, Your Team
The Social Commerce Engagement specialist supports QVC UK, and drives social commerce engagement, affiliate creator partnerships, and influencer activation across key social platforms.
Where You'll Work
This role is hybrid and will require you to be onsite at Chiswick Park, West London, two days a week. Some weekend support may be required as part of the role.
What You'll Do
- Drive a proactive social commerce engagement strategy across TikTok, Meta, YouTube and emerging platforms to build market awareness and strengthen positive brand sentiment.
- Act as the primary contact for TikTok Shop affiliate creators, managing onboarding, communication, relationship development and ongoing support to help deliver social commerce revenue targets.
- Coordinate and nurture affiliate & influencer relationships across Meta, YouTube and other relevant channels, including bookings, campaign integration and performance optimisation.
- Monitor, analyse and report on affiliate creator and influencer performance, using insights to refine strategy, improve engagement and maximise commercial impact.
- Keep abreast of wider social commerce trends, competitor activity and emerging live shopping platforms, sharing recommendations and opportunities with internal stakeholders.
What You'll Bring
- Proven experience in social media, social commerce, influencer marketing, or a related field, with 3 to 5 years' experience ideally gained in an ecommerce environment.
- Strong knowledge of TikTok, Meta and YouTube, with experience developing engagement strategies, managing creator or influencer relationships, and supporting campaign execution.
- Commercial awareness, strong analytical skills and the ability to translate performance data into actionable recommendations.
-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, with the confidence to collaborate across teams and engage external partners effectively.
- A highly organised, proactive and entrepreneurial approach, with a strong aesthetic sense and an understanding of customer behaviour across social and digital channels.
